Panasonic LA-305D Sensor - RED LED THRU 5X300MM,0.05MM DIA. RECEIVER Simple Type: Sensor

The LA-300 series of LED collimated beam sensors provides a compact, safe alternative to laser diode types. The compact size of the sensor heads allows for versatile placement in your machine. Two sensor heads are available with a maximum sensing range of 500mm with a 10mm wide beam (LA-310). Beam alignment is simplified by incorporating a 3-stage stability indicator along with a target label for accurate positioning of the incident light beam. Two comparative outputs (NPN or PNP) and one analog output (1 to 5V) are integrated for simple configuration. Also, shift and span adjustments of the analog output are possible with the controller.

Specifications

    General
  • Accessories: MS-LA3-2 (Sensor head mounting bracket): 1 set for emitter and receiver, Target label: 2 pcs.
  • Ambient humidity: 35 to 85 % RH, Storage: 35 to 85 % RH
  • Ambient illuminance: Incandescent light: 10,000 lx at the light-receiving face
  • Ambient temperature: 0 to +40 °C +32 to +104 °F (No dew condensation), Storage: -20 to +70 °C -4 to +158 °F
  • Applicable amplifiers: LA-A1, LA-A1P
  • Beam width: 5 mm 0.197 in
  • Cable: 0.18 mm2 3-core composite cabtyre cable, 2 m 6.562 ft long
  • Cable extension: Extension up to total 10 m 32.808 ft is possible, for both emitter and receiver, with 0.18 mm2, or more, cable. (Shield wire must be extended with shield wire.)
  • EMC: EN 61000-6-2, EN 61000-6-4
  • Emitting element: Red LED-(Peak emission wavelength 650 nm 0.026 mil, modulated)
  • Insulation resistance: 20 MO, or more, with 250 V DC megger between all supply terminals connected together and enclosure
  • Material: Enclosure: Heat-resistant ABS Cover: Heat-resistant ABS, Front cover: Glass
  • Min. sensing object: ø0.05 mm ø0.002 in opaque object
  • Net weight: Emitter: 70 g approx., Receiver: 70 g approx.
  • Pollution degree: 3 (Industrial environment)
  • Repeatability: Perpendicular to sensing axis: 0.01 mm 0.0004 in or less
  • Sensing range: 300 mm 11.811 in
  • Shock resistance: 500 m/s2 acceleration (50 G approx.) in X, Y and Z directions for three times each
  • Temperature characteristics: 0.2 % F.S./°C or less
  • Vibration resistance: 10 to 150 Hz frequency, 0.75 mm 0.030 in amplitude in X, Y and Z directions for two hours each
  • Voltage withstandability: 1,000 V AC for one min. between all supply terminals connected together and enclosure
